Marie Curie

"This book looks at the ... life of Marie Curie, who succeeded in the world of science at a time when women were not expected to have careers. She won two Nobel Prizes for her discovery of radium and her work on radiation. This book describes her struggle to succeed in difficult circumstances, her scientific discoveries, and the medical benefits we have today thanks to her efforts."--Back cover.

Marie Curie for kids

her life and scientific discoveries, with 21 activities and experiments
2017
" ... Marie Curie for Kids details Curie's remarkable life, from her childhood under a repressive czar in Poland to her tireless work supporting herself through college to meeting her ideal match in scientist Pierre Curie to her revolutionary research. Kids learn how Curie quietly flouted societal norms, working in full partnership with her husband while also teaching and raising two daughters. Scientific concepts are presented in a clear, accessible way, and a range of activities--from making Polish pierogi to exploring magnetism, to using electrolysis to split water--allow for exploration of Curie's life, times, and work."--Provided by publisher.
